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ature aguantaba aguantado
Definition Primera persona del singular (yo) del pretérito imperfecto de indicativo de aguantar o de aguantarse. Participio de aguantar o de aguantarse.

Visual trap between aguantaba and aguantado

A purely visual mix-up. aguantaba ([aɣ̞wãn̪ˈt̪aβ̞a]) and aguantado ([aɣ̞wãn̪ˈt̪að̞o])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one. On the page they stay close: they share most of their letters but differ in 2 positions.
